Acrochordons as a cutaneous sign of metabolic syndrome: a case-control study.

What was done
A case-control study compared 110 patients with two or more acrochordons to 110 age- and gender-matched controls. Investigators recorded skin tag localization, size, and total count, and measured body mass index, waist circumference, smoking status, fasting plasma glucose, impaired glucose tolerance, insulin resistance, serum lipids, liver enzymes, and arterial blood pressure in both groups.
What was found
Diabetes mellitus was diagnosed in 58 of 110 patients with acrochordons compared to 12 of 110 controls, which was statistically significant. Impaired glucose tolerance was found in 16 of 110 patients (15%) and 9 of 110 controls (8%), a non-significant difference. Mean levels of fasting plasma glucose, body mass index, insulin resistance, total cholesterol, low-density lipoprotein cholesterol, triglycerides, and systolic and diastolic blood pressure were significantly higher in patients than controls, while high-density lipoprotein levels were lower. Exact numerical means, standard deviations, and p-values for laboratory and blood pressure values were not reported in the abstract.
Why it matters
The presence of multiple skin tags during routine examination may indicate an increased likelihood of metabolic syndrome and prompt clinical screening for dyslipidemia and glucose intolerance.
Limits
The case-control design cannot establish causality or temporal relationships. The abstract omits exact numerical values, effect sizes, and p-values for most metabolic and lipid parameters. Findings may be subject to selection bias and unmeasured confounding.
